This is my interpretation of the Porsche 993 GT2 convertible. It was my first real foray into cutting pieces off of HW cars after finally getting a rotary tool, and I think it turned out surprisingly well!
My bad cutting led to a lot of sanding, but I was able to at last get the tub to look pretty smooth aftet removing the roof.
The orange color was inspired by the awesome Singer 911s, while with the wheels I tried to do a homage to the 911 50th anniversary edition Fuchs lookalikes. I think I might actually still modify them by filling in the cavities with a drop of JB Kwik, but I think it looks decent as is already.
I think next I'll do a classic 911 Targa homage using another 993 donor chassis. Forrest green with black roof.
